You don’t get named a James Beard finalist for Outstanding Bar without knowing how to make a world-class cocktail. Drastic Measures sits in a small and unassuming storefront in downtown Shawnee, but the drinks are anything but unassuming. Serving only cocktails (no wine, no beer), Drastic Measures is able to mix up something for every drinker’s palate.

Not many places capture the essence of Kansas City better than Green Lady Lounge. Live Jazz 365 days a year, candlelit tables, and meaningful conversation; history abounds between these walls. Always a great option for a late-night stop when showcasing KC to your out-of-town friends.

If you're feeling an upscale evening on the Plaza, a nightcap at The Monarch Bar is a must. The luxurious interior is defined by the marble bar in the center, where you can watch your mixologist create a liquid masterpiece. Their cocktail menu changes seasonally, just like the winged creature the bar is named after.

Nestled in the heart of the West Bottoms, The Ship is truly a “sunken treasure”. Featuring live music, a full food and drink menu, and (of course) a nautical-themed space that will have you telling all your mates to come join you for a drink.

“Wait, there’s a bar back here?” Tucked behind an airstream camper is a hidden courtyard that is argued to be one of the coolest spaces in Kansas City. Structured primarily by shipping containers, Panther’s Place is adorned by lush greenery, a metal spiral staircase, and an old dent-filled van. Check their Instagram for their daily hours (subject to change) and be sure to head there as the sun goes down as the vibe only gets better.

If you appreciate curated design and aesthetically pleasing touches, then you’re gonna love The Primrose in Mission. Co-owner Abby Hans has designed the space to be a cozy neighborhood cocktail bar that community members can stop by for a cocktail after a long day’s work. You won’t regret an order of their signature drink, The Primrose, which features gin, vermouth, Campari, rosemary, lemon, orange, and egg white served in a smoked rosemary-infused glass.

For a truly elevated cocktail experience in Kansas City, look no further than The Mercury Room. Situated on the top floor of the ReVerb apartment building in the Crossroads, The Mercury Room offers sweeping vistas of the KC skyline while gently lit by string lights adorning the ceiling. Reservations are required and a dress code is enforced, so plan ahead for an unforgettable date night.

Just across Main Street from its sister restaurant and local favorite, Tailleur, sits Cheval; a beautifully-styled lounge serving cocktails, share plates, desserts, and wines. Owner Heather White designed the space to represent “triumph and success” just like the horses the Bar is named after (Cheval means “horse” in French). No reservations are required, so stop in during your next visit to Midtown.
